About The Position

The Director of Catering & Events oversees all Catering and Events operations, including team leadership, business strategy, client contracts, and exceptional event service. In partnership with the Sales team, this role ensures profitable, high-quality operations; coordinates conferences, meetings, and weddings to meet client expectations; maximizes hotel revenue through upselling, function space, and room block management; and ensures both the Company and clients fulfill group contract commitments.

Responsibilities

  • Lead, coach, schedule, and develop the Catering and Events team, including hiring, training, performance management, and corrective action when needed.
  • Oversee assigned groups, weddings, meetings, and events from pre-planning through departure, including event detailing, BEO’s, resumes, day-of execution, and post-event follow-up.
  • Develop and implement departmental goals, operating procedures, and service standards that support company objectives.
  • Communicate sales and event information clearly to hotel departments and promote teamwork through regular meetings and daily coordination.
  • Represent the Company professionally with internal and external stakeholders and support a positive, service-focused culture.
  • Address guest and client concerns related to in-house events, and communicate resolutions to the Group Director of Sales & Marketing as necessary.
  • Assist with developing policies and procedures related to in-house event planning and execution.
  • Negotiate meeting room rental, function space, hotel services, and event terms within approved booking guidelines.
  • Prepare, review, and manage sales contracts, rate agreements, banquet/catering event orders, and event resumes accurately and on time.
  • Respond to inquiries and prepare client proposals in accordance with departmental standards.
  • Prepare monthly sales-related reports and forecasts for assigned areas of responsibility.
  • Lead BEO meetings for in-house events and ensure event details are communicated to all relevant departments.
  • Support resort programming, special cultural events, entertainment bookings, and activity calendars as assigned.
  • Coordinate with Marketing and the Group Director of Sales & Marketing to promote special events.
